Engineering MeCP2 to spy on its targets

Nature Medicine 23, 1120 (2017). doi:10.1038/nm.4425 Authors: Patricia M Horvath & Lisa M Monteggia A new mouse model of Rett syndrome, in which MECP2 can be selectively biotinylated, allows for the investigation of cell-specific effects of Rett-causing mutations on gene expression, particularly in female mice.
